パーミッションの設定

他のメンバを追加する場合は、アカウントを新規作成する必要があるが、毎回パーミッションの設定をするのは非常に手間がかかる。そこで、グルーピング機能を有効に使えば作業は楽になる。グループ名でパーミッションを設定し、追加するメンバをこのグループに所属させるとよい。


anonymousのアクセス権限を削除する。

f:id:Kaz-Xeon:20080113145717j:image


グループ名(以下の例はdeveloperというグループ名)のパーミッションを設定する。(Tracが動作するDOS窓にて、以下のコマンドを実行する)

trac-admin <PJのパス>  add developer LOG_VIEW FILE_VIEW 
WIKI_VIEW WIKI_CREATE WIKI_MODIFY SEARCH_VIEW REPORT_VIEW REPORT_SQL_VIEW
 TICKET_VIEW TICKET_CREATE TICKET_MODIFY BROWSER_VIEW TIMELINE_VIEW 
CHANGESET_VIEW ROADMAP_VIEW MILESTONE_VIEW DISCUSSION_VIEW DISCUSSION_APPEND 


メンバのパーミッション設定

Add Subject to Group:

のメニューのSubjectに追加するメンバのアカウント名を入力する。Group欄には、「develper」を入力する。

f:id:Kaz-Xeon:20080113150056j:image